Farmer plants 6,000 trees in the shape of a heart as a tribute to his beloved late wife.
Loving husband Winston Howes was desperate to find a lasting way to show that wife Janet would always be in his heart. Two years after Janet died suddenly aged 50 he spent a week planting thousands of oak trees in a six-acre field - leaving a perfect heart shape.
